There are many seasonal raptor closures with varying dates and specific boundaries. These generally effect The Monument, Kiss of the Lepers, Picnic Lunch Wall and/or Smith Rock group, and possibly elsewhere. These usually run from February to the beginning of August, but each closure is usually shorter than this, and is dependent on the birds' behavior. Description
Just left of 'Dat be up the butt Bob' is a fun gear route and one of the first routes put up at the Northern Point. Stem up the crack to the prominent roof then jam and pull through super fun holds to a rest cave. Clip the bolt protecting the crux and work your magic through a tricky and reachy sequence of moves. The climbing eases up top. The addition of the crux bolt has taken away the original R rating.
